1.Analysis of p16 gene deletion and mutation in gastric carcinoma
Guohai ZHAO ; Tiechen LI ; Lianghui SHI ; Yabin XIA ; Huilan SUN ; Dunf PENG
Chinese Journal of Pathophysiology 1989;0(05):-
AIM: To investigate p16 gene alterations in gastric carcinoma. METHODS: 36 fresh tumor specimens taken from gastric cancer patients were analyzed for p16 gene deletion and mutation by polymerase chain reaction (PCR) and DNA sequencing. RESULTS: Homozygous deletion of exon 1 and exon 3 was observed in 2 cases and 3 cases of diffuse carcinoma, respectively. The frequency of homozygous deletion was 13.89%. No p16 gene point mutation was detected. CONCLUSION: The deletion of p16 genes may be related to gastric carcinogenesis.

3.Cryopreservation of microencapsulated human hepatocytes.
Hualian HANG ; Yabin YU ; Jianmin BIAN ; Qiang XIA
Chinese Journal of Hepatology 2014;22(9):686-692
OBJECTIVETo establish a stable method of isolation, culture and cryopreservation of adult primary hepatocytes to provide potential hepatocyte resources for therapeutic usage in hepatocyte transplantation and bioartificial liver support systems for the treatment of acute and chronic liver diseases,and for experimental usage as an in vitro model of the liver.
METHODSAdult hepatocytes from 20 human donors undergoing partial hepatectomy were isolated using a two-step extracoporeal collagenase perfusion technique.Seven preincubation time points (2h,6h,12h,24h,36h,48h and 72h) were selected for optimization.After pre-incubation at 4 degrees C for 12-24h in HepatoZYME-SFM (the optimal condition),hepatocytes were microencapsulated using alginate-poly-L-lysine-alginate microcapsules,transferred to a complete medium containing 10% dimethyl sulphoxide and immediately placed into an isopropanol progressive freezing container for overnight freezing at -80 degrees C followed by immersion in liquid nitrogen the next day.During the post-thawing culture period,the cells were tested for albumin secretion,urea synthesis,cell cycling,transcription and protein synthesis (measuring mRNA and protein levels),and the morphological structure and pathology,for comparison with the features from before microencapsulated cryopreservation (PMC).
RESULTSThe viability and plating efficiency of the hepatocytes isolated using the two-step extracorporeal collagenase perfusion technique were 75.0+/-4.6% and 72.0+/-6.0%,respectively.The pre-incubation times of 12h and 24h (viability:61.4+/-4.8% and 62.0+/-5.6%; plating efficiency:3.2+/-5.8% and 62.6+/-3.6%,respectively) showed significantly higher albumin secretion than all other time points tested (F =40.3,all P less than 0.05).Compared with the immediate cryopreservation (immediately frozen control) hepatocytes,the PMC hepatocytes showed significantly better transcription and protein synthesis and higher albumin secretion and urea levels.The PMC group did not show a significantly different level of albumin production from the directly cultured hepatocytes (culture day 2:ll9.2ng/ml vs.131.36ng/ml,P =0.051; day 3:110ng/ml vs.120.4ng/ml,P=0.063; day 4:98.2ng/ml vs.109.8ng/ml,P more than 0.05).However,over culturing days 2,3 and 4,comparison of the PMC hepatocytes to the immediate cryopreservation hepatoeytes showed the former to have significantly higher secretion of albumin (119.2ng/ml vs.101.2ng/ml,110.0ng/ml vs.87.6ng/ml and 98.2ng/ml vs.73.8ng/ml; all P less than 0.05) and urea level (7.83 mug/ml vs.6.79 mug/ml,6.83 mug/ml vs.5.89 mug/ml and 5.85 mug/ml vs.4.83 mug/ml; all P less than 0.05).The post-thawed PMC hepatoeytes showed preservation of the morphological structure,while the immediate cryopreservation hepatocytes did not.
CONCLUSIONThe two-step extracorporeal collagenase perfusion technique after partial hepatectomy is a novel,simple,and reliable method for hepatocyte isolation.Pre-incubation at 4 degrees C for 12-24h before the microencapsulation cryopreservation allows for efficient recovery of functional and morphological integrity after thawing and provides viable hepatoeytes that may be useful for clinical applications in pharmacotoxicology,bioartificial liver therapy and cell therapy in humans.

4.The research progress on the correlation between metabolic syndrome and lumbar disc herniation
Yabin YU ; Jiaqiang HUANG ; Hong XIA
Journal of Chinese Physician 2018;20(2):315-318
Metabolic syndrome is a group of clinical syndromes characterized by overweight or obesity, hypertension, dyslipidemia, impaired glucose metabolism, and insulin resistance.It is a group of metabolic associated risk factors.Lumbar disc herniation (LDH) is one of the most common diseases nowadays, and its risk factors include obesity, diabetes, and abnormal blood lipid.In recent years, the relationship between LDH and metabolic syndrome (MetS) has been valued by scholars.Although some studies have suggested that MetS is related to LDH, the study of the correlation between MetS and LDH at home and abroad is relatively rare.To explore the possibility of using MetS for the prevention and control of LDH, this paper reviews the research progress of the relationship among MetS, the various components, and LDH.
5.Congenital tracheobiliary fistula treated with biological glue plugging under bronchoscopic guidance:a case report and literature review
Xia CHEN ; Yuqun YAN ; Wenhua DENG ; Jiahong REN ; Junhua SHU ; Yabin WU
Chinese Journal of Applied Clinical Pediatrics 2018;33(11):839-841
Objective To investigate the clinical characteristics,diagnosis and treatment of congenital tracheobiliary fistula (CTBF) in children.Methods A case of CTBF admitted into the Department of Pediatric Respiration,Hubei Maternal and Child Health Care Hospital in 2016 was reported,and the related literatures were reviewed.The clinical features,diagnostic methods,treatment status and clinical outcomes of the disease were analyzed.Results The patient was 3 years and 7 months old.The main clinical manifestations were recurrent cough,pneumonia and atelectasis.CTBF was diagnosed by means of iodine oil radiography and treated with biological glue plugging under bronchoscopic guidance.So far,only 30 cases of CTBF have been reported in the English literatures,but only 2 cases in the Chinese literatures.The main clinical manifestations were cough,dyspnea,sputum or bile vomiting,aspiration pneumonia,atelectasis or emphysema.Diagnostic methods for CTBF included bronchoscopy,bronchial angiography and cholangiography,hepatobiliary scan,CT scan and magnetic resonance imaging.Except for this case treated with biological glue plugging under bronchoscopic guidance,all other patients were treated with surgery.The operation methods included fistula ligation,gastrostomy,liver resection,fistula jejunum Roux-en-Y anastomosis,hepatic hilum jejunum anastomosis,gallbladder jejunum anastomosis,etc.Only 4 cases died,and the rest of the patients recovered.Conclusions CTBF should be suspected in children with persistent chronic cough.Iodine oil radiography through bronchoscopy is a simple and feasible method for diagnosis of CTBF.Besides surgery,the lavage and the biological glue plugging method through bronchoscopy is also an effective way to treat CTBF in children without severe biliary malformation.
6.Association between quantitative CT-measured body composition and metabolic syndrome components in obese patients before bariatric surgery
Wei HONG ; Xiaojun HAO ; Chao TAO ; Pengzhan YIN ; Yabin XIA ; Yan JIN ; Yunfeng ZHOU
Chinese Journal of Health Management 2024;18(2):127-134
Objective:To investigate the association between quantified CT (QCT)-measured body composition and metabolic syndrome (MS) components in obese populations before bariatric surgery.Methods:A cross-sectional study. A retrospective analysis was conducted on a cohort of 97 obese patients scheduled for weight-loss surgery at the First Affiliated Hospital of Wannan Medical College from January 2021 to March 2023. The patients′ body mass index (BMI), biochemical parameters and body composition measurements obtained by QCT were recorded. The patients were stratified into groups based on gender, obesity severity and the number of MS components. Differences in body composition among the groups were compared. Additionally, the correlations between each body composition parameter and metabolic indicators were analyzed. The diagnostic efficacy of each body composition parameter for identifying obese individuals with different MS components was assessed using receiver operating characteristic (ROC) curve analysis.Results:There were 75 females (77.3%). Male obese patients had higher total abdominal fat area [(693.23±148.90) vs (574.99±114.89) cm 2, t=-3.958, P<0.001], visceral fat area [(289.65±57.67) vs (195.60±57.37) cm 2, t=-6.753, P<0.001], fat content of pancreatic head [27.45%(21.65%, 45.48%) vs 21.60%(17.6%, 26.9%), Z=-2.675, P=0.007], and skeletal muscle index [73.36(68.74, 81.26) vs 61.52(55.74, 66.41) cm 2/m 2, Z=-5.246, P<0.001]. With the increase of obesity, abdominal fat mainly increases in subcutaneous fat. With the increase of MS components (MS2 group, MS3 group, MS4 group, MS5 group), the abdominal fat area, abdominal fat/subcutaneous fat, liver fat content, pancreatic head fat content, and skeletal muscle index of patients all increased accordingly. In diagnosing the presence of two components of MS, area under the curve of visceral fat area was the largest (AUC=0.706, 95% CI=0.577-0.834). For diagnosing the presence of three, four and five components of MS, area under curve of liver fat content were all the largest (MS3=0.712, 95% CI=0.605-0.818; MS4=0.652, 95% CI=0.537-0.766; MS5=0.706, 95% CI=0.576-0.836). Conclusion:There are differences in QCT body composition among obese patients with different MS components, and there is a correlation between each body composition and MS component. Among them, intra-abdominal fat area and liver fat content are of great value in evaluating obese patients with different MS components.
7.Analysis of surgical situations and prognosis of pancreaticoduodenectomy in Jiangsu province (a report of 2 886 cases)
Zipeng LU ; Xin GAO ; Hao CHENG ; Ning WANG ; Kai ZHANG ; Jie YIN ; Lingdi YIN ; Youting LIN ; Xinrui ZHU ; Dongzhi WANG ; Hongqin MA ; Tongtai LIU ; Yongzi XU ; Daojun ZHU ; Yabin YU ; Yang YANG ; Fei LIU ; Chao PAN ; Jincao TANG ; Minjie HU ; Zhiyuan HUA ; Fuming XUAN ; Leizhou XIA ; Dong QIAN ; Yong WANG ; Susu WANG ; Wentao GAO ; Yudong QIU ; Dongming ZHU ; Yi MIAO ; Kuirong JIANG
Chinese Journal of Digestive Surgery 2024;23(5):685-693
Objective:To investigate the surgical situations and perioperative outcome of pancreaticoduodenectomy in Jiangsu Province and the influencing factors for postoperative 90-day mortality.Methods:The retrospective case-control study was conducted. The clinicopathological data of 2 886 patients who underwent pancreaticoduodenectomy in 21 large tertiary hospitals of Jiangsu Quality Control Center for Pancreatic Diseases, including The First Affiliated Hospital of Nanjing Medical University, from March 2021 to December 2022 were collected. There were 1 732 males and 1 154 females, aged 65(57,71)years. Under the framework of the Jiangsu Provincial Pancreatic Disease Quality Control Project, the Jiangsu Quality Control Center for Pancreatic Diseases adopted a multi-center registration research method to establish a provincial electronic database for pancrea-ticoduodenectomy. Observation indicators: (1) clinical characteristics; (2) intraoperative and post-operative conditions; (3) influencing factors for 90-day mortality after pancreaticoduodenectomy. Measurement data with skewed distribution were represented as M( Q1, Q3) or M(IQR), and comparison between groups was conducted using the Mann-Whitney U test. Count data were expressed as absolute numbers or constituent ratio, and comparison between groups was conducted using the chi-square test, continuity correction chi-square test and Fisher exact probability. Maximal Youden index method was used to determine the cutoff value of continuous variables. Univariate analysis was performed using the corresponding statistical methods based on data types. Multivariate analysis was performed using the Logistic multiple regression model. Results:(1) Clinical characteristics. Of the 2 886 patients who underwent pancreaticoduodenectomy, there were 1 175 and 1 711 cases in 2021 and 2022, respectively. Of the 21 hospitals, 8 hospitals had an average annual surgical volume of <36 cases for pancreaticoduodenectomy, 10 hospitals had an average annual surgical volume of 36-119 cases, and 3 hospitals had an average annual surgical volume of ≥120 cases. There were 2 584 cases performed pancreaticoduodenectomy in thirteen hospitals with an average annual surgical volume of ≥36 cases, accounting for 89.536%(2 584/2 886)of the total cases. There were 1 357 cases performed pancrea-ticoduodenectomy in three hospitals with an average annual surgical volume of ≥120 cases, accounting for 47.020%(1 357/2 886) of the total cases. (2) Intraoperative and postoperative conditions. Of the 2 886 patients, the surgical approach was open surgery in 2 397 cases, minimally invasive surgery in 488 cases, and it is unknown in 1 case. The pylorus was preserved in 871 cases, not preserved in 1 952 cases, and it is unknown in 63 cases. Combined organ resection was performed in 305 cases (including vascular resection in 209 cases), not combined organ resection in 2 579 cases, and it is unknown in 2 cases. The operation time of 2 885 patients was 290(115)minutes, the volume of intra-operative blood loss of 2 882 patients was 240(250)mL, and the intraoperative blood transfusion rate of 2 880 patients was 27.153%(782/2 880). Of the 2 886 patients, the invasive treatment rate was 11.342%(327/2 883), the unplanned Intensive Care Unit (ICU) treatment rate was 3.087%(89/2 883), the reoperation rate was 1.590%(45/2 830), the duration of postoperative hospital stay was 17(11)days, the hospitalization mortality rate was 0.798%(23/2 882), and the failure rate of rescue data in 2 083 cases with severe complications was 6.529%(19/291). There were 2 477 patients receiving postoperative 90-day follow-up, with the 90-day mortality of 2.705%(67/2477). The total incidence rate of complication in 2 886 patients was 58.997%(1 423/2 412). The incidence rate of severe complication was 13.970%(291/2 083). The comprehensive complication index was 8.7(22.6) in 2 078 patients. (3) Influencing factors for 90-day mortality after pancreaticoduodenectomy. Results of multivariate analysis showed that age ≥ 70 years, postoperative invasive treatment, and unplanned ICU treatment were independent risk factors for 90-day mortality after pancreaticoduodenectomy ( odds ratio=2.403, 2.609, 16.141, 95% confidence interval as 1.281-4.510, 1.298-5.244, 7.119-36.596, P<0.05). Average annual surgical volume ≥36 cases in the hospital was an independent protective factor for 90-day mortality after pancreaticoduodenectomy ( odds ratio=0.368, 95% confidence interval as 0.168-0.808, P<0.05). Conclusions:Pancreaticoduodenectomy in Jiangsu Province is highly con-centrated in some hospitals, with a high incidence of postoperative complications, and the risk of postoperative 90-day mortality is significant higher than that of hospitallization mortality. Age ≥ 70 years, postoperative invasive treatment, and unplanned ICU treatment are independent risk factors for 90-day motality after pancreaticoduodenectomy, and average annual surgical volume ≥36 cases in the hospital is an independent protective factor.
